Creating a Detailed Cleaning Scope of Work to Prevent Missed Tasks
A comprehensive and clearly defined cleaning scope of work is one of the most effective ways to avoid missed tasks in any professional cleaning program. When each area of your facility is delineated with precise action items, you minimize confusion among cleaning personnel and ensure that your highest-priority tasks are completed in a timely manner. For instance, specifying that floors must be vacuumed daily while windows are cleaned weekly sets clear expectations and keeps quality consistent. This structure also provides a solid foundation for ongoing communication, as stakeholders know exactly which activities are scheduled and when they will be carried out.
It is helpful to go beyond just listing tasks in a general manner. Break your scope of work into categories tailored to the unique needs of your property. Include a section covering daily tasks, a section for weekly tasks, and additional sections for monthly, quarterly, or annual deep-clean procedures. Some examples might include daily emptying of trash receptacles, weekly sanitization of breakroom appliances, and quarterly steam cleaning of carpets. By mapping out each area's requirements according to a set schedule, you reduce the risk of neglecting or postponing essential responsibilities. Furthermore, documenting these specifics helps your cleaning team stay organized and promotes accountability across every shift.
Another effective approach is to outline any special protocols your facility requires, such as extra disinfection for sensitive areas or unique waste disposal procedures. Providing these details ensures the team knows how to handle specialized tasks, reducing the likelihood of oversight. If any changes to the scope of work arise, update the document promptly to reflect new requirements and maintain a high level of service quality. Over time, a well-documented plan also simplifies your ability to review, assess, and refine the scope for even stronger results.
